Patrick Stinnett was nominated by a student.

"On the first day of freshman year at Kettle Moraine High School, it's a little cloudy outside, and I have no idea what to expect. Besides liking computers, I would describe myself as a girl who had no idea who she was. As I walked into the graphic design room, I was excited to see what I would work with: over 20 monitors on desks, two vinyl cutting machines, a giant printer, two heat presses, and a giant setup for screen printing. I had never touched these items before and was ready to start my graphic design career. I had no clue what to expect, and this is how I kick it off," said the student.

"As I walked further into the room, I saw my teacher, Mr. Stinnett. He was ready for the year, with a smile and the seating chart in the middle of the room. I looked down at the chart and noticed something. I was one of five girls in the class. I looked up at him with a sigh as he said, 'I know it's going to be a long but fun semester, so get ready!' With that, I put on my mental armor and got ready. He would always pause the class if someone had questions to ensure they were on the right track. He was okay with us working ahead as long as we stayed on track, but we were warned. With that sentence, I was practically soaring. I would play with all of Adobe's different tools and try to find shortcuts to what he was saying. The whole semester was like that, and it was perfect. He would add to my crazy designs and always encourage creativity within all of his students," said the student.

"When designing things, I would always be the student he would use for examples. He would even ask if I wanted to help with nearby activities, which he would typically ask his marketing team. It was so cold while I was at a Halloween trick-or-treating event in Delafield. He let me use a sweatshirt that we were supposed to be selling. That is one of the many examples that made me feel like an actual human being. Mr. Stinnett is always very interactive with us students," said the student. "This is why Mr. Stinnett is my favorite educator!"
